The Clinical Supervisor provides direct clinical supervision, mentorship, and professional development support to Associate Marriage and Family Therapists (AMFTs), trainees, interns, and Alcohol and Other Drug (AOD) counselors working toward licensure and/or certification. This position ensures ethical, compliant, and high-quality clinical services while fostering clinician development, retention, and connection to CADA’s mission. The Clinical Supervisor supports documentation quality, regulatory compliance, and professional growth of supervisees while ensuring services meet standards required by Medi-Cal, Santa Barbara County Behavioral Wellness, the California Board of Behavioral Sciences (BBS), and AOD certifying organizations.
This is a non-exempt, full-time position that is eligible for medical/vision/dental benefits, vacation, sick, and holiday pay. 30 hours/week.
Salary range: $42-$46, dependent on qualifications and experience
In compliance with the California Department of Health Care Services, staff require an up-to-date Tuberculosis test during the duration of employment.
